Wes Posted May 19, 2013 Share Posted May 19, 2013 Flip side is - If he isn't good enough for team football - why pay him a wage ? - People who are squad players need to be good enough to make an impact at first team level. Packing the squad with sub standard players doesn't help anyone. You're right of course. An ideal situation is that you have starter quality players to fill your starting 11 and bench but only a handful of clubs in the league have the resources to manage that and we're not one of them at this stage of our transition. The goal of course is continual gradual improvement of the quality of the players throughout the club but this isn't going to happen instantaneously. Clubs fall down sharpish when they try to do this (ie. QPR). I would rather keep Herd likely on a wage around £10k as he is someone we know can play anywhere across the back or base of midfield if we're completely pushed with regards injuries and suspensions instead of bringing in a new third choice right back, centre back and defensive midfielder to cater for those eventualities. Even if we promoted youth players to fufill these versatile roles they'll be asking for wages similiar to Herd. That said, Herd is in the final year of his contract and may be looking for first team opportunities himself so selling him this year may be the best situation for both camps.
